Precautions for Suspension
B827H12000001
Refer to “General Precautions in Section 00 (Page 00-1)”.
WARNING
!
All suspensions, bolts and nuts are an important part in that it could affect the performance of vital
parts. They must be tightened to the specified torque periodically and if the suspension effect is lost,
replace it with a new one.
CAUTION
!
Never attempt to heat, quench or straighten any suspension part. Replace it with a new one, or
damage to the part may result.
NOTE
The right and left suspension related parts (shock absorbers, suspension arms and knuckles) are
installed symmetrically and therefore the removal procedure for one side is the same as that for the
other side.
